  20. def withQueryHandler[T](handler: (Request) => PreparedResponse)(f: (MongoConnection) => T)(implicit d: AsyncDriver, m: ConnectionManager[ConnectionHandler], ec: ExecutionContext, compose: ComposeWithCompletion[T]): Outer

    Works with a MongoDB driver handling only queries, using given query handler.

    Works with a MongoDB driver handling only queries, using given query handler. Driver and associated resources are released after the function f the result Future is completed.

    handler

    Query handler

    import scala.concurrent.ExecutionContext
    
    import reactivemongo.api.{ AsyncDriver, MongoConnection }
    import acolyte.reactivemongo.{ AcolyteDSL, PreparedResponse, Request }
    
    def aResponse: PreparedResponse = ???
    
    def foo(implicit ec: ExecutionContext, d: AsyncDriver) =
      AcolyteDSL.withQueryHandler({ (_: Request) => aResponse }) {
        (_: MongoConnection) => "aResult"
      }

  21. def withWriteHandler[T](handler: (WriteOp, Request) => PreparedResponse)(f: (MongoConnection) => T)(implicit d: AsyncDriver, m: ConnectionManager[ConnectionHandler], ec: ExecutionContext, compose: ComposeWithCompletion[T]): Outer

    Works with a MongoDB driver handling only write operations, using given write handler.

    Works with a MongoDB driver handling only write operations, using given write handler. Driver and associated resources are released after the function f the result Future is completed.

    handler

    Writer handler

    import scala.concurrent.ExecutionContext
    
    import reactivemongo.api.AsyncDriver
    import acolyte.reactivemongo.{
      AcolyteDSL, PreparedResponse, Request, WriteOp
    }
    
    def aResp: PreparedResponse = ???
    
    def foo(implicit ec: ExecutionContext, d: AsyncDriver) =
      AcolyteDSL.withWriteHandler({ (_: WriteOp, _: Request) => aResp }) { _ =>
        "aResult"
      }
